Prime Minister Attends Funeral of Shaheed Captain Faraz Ilyas

Islamabad,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if attended the funeral and burial of Captain Faraz Ilyas near Chunian, who was recently martyred in a terrorist attack in Lakki Marwat along with six other soldiers. The ceremony included full military honors and was attended by Federal Information Minister Attaullah Tarar, high-ranking military officials, and a significant number of locals.

According to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Prime Minister Sharif laid a floral wreath on Captain Ilyas’s grave and offered prayers. He paid tribute to the sacrifices of the armed forces in the fight against terrorism and emphasized that such sacrifices would never be in vain. In a gesture of honor, the Prime Minister announced the renaming of the village after Captain Ilyas and plans to develop it into a model village, reflecting the nation’s respect and recognition for his service.
